LAS VEGAS (KSNV) — The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department has recorded seven officer-involved shootings through the first half of 2026, matching the total number reported during all of 2025.
At the end of last year, Sheriff Kevin McMahill highlighted a nearly 60% decrease in officer-involved shootings compared to previous years. However, that total has already been reached by June.
“It’s not an anomaly to have officer-involved shootings,” said Steve Grammas, president of the Las Vegas Police Protective Association…
